The Fifth Gear of Leadership invites readers into the transformational journey of Jack, a well¿meaning manager who discovers that leadership isn't a title - it's a shift in consciousness. Jack begins in Neutral, technically in charge but emotionally disengaged, reacting to problems rather than leading through them. As he moves through five metaphorical gears, he evolves from a passive, compliance¿driven supervisor into a leader defined by clarity, empathy, accountability, and purpose.Each gear represents a distinct stage of leadership maturity:First Gear: Passive management, avoidance, and low moraleSecond Gear: Task¿driven control and early awarenessThird Gear: Relational leadership built on trust and vulnerabilityFourth Gear: Accountability, integrity, and values¿aligned actionFifth Gear: Transformational leadership rooted in presence, influence, and legacyGrounded in the principles of Management By Responsibility (MBR), Jack's story becomes a practical roadmap for leaders who want to move beyond reactive habits and step into intentional, conscious leadership.The book is cöauthored by John Wandolowski, BSE/MBA, a seasoned leader, storyteller, and mentor whose own career began on the shop floor as a second¿shift maintenance supervisor. After discovering MBR, John rose to leadership roles at Johnson & Johnson, CIBA Vision, and Advocate Healthcare. His work blends emotional intelligence, practical insight, and visual storytelling to help leaders shift from control to conviction.Dr. Michael Durst, PhD, creator of MBR, has spent decades helping leaders unlock their potential through clarity, accountability, and purpose. His pioneering leadership philosophy forms the backbone of this book. After retiring from consulting, Dr. Durst became an internationally acclaimed artist, known for his award¿winning Fractal Impressionism and exhibitions across Europe and the United States.Together, Wandolowski and Durst offer a compelling, human¿centered guide for anyone ready to shift gears and lead with intention.
